___________________________________________________________________________________________________________A Legion Warrior, otherwise just known as a Warrior, is your standard looking wolf, and is a close relative of the Timber wolf. A Legion Warrior, however, has distinctively unique pelts. Their designs defy those of the natural wolf's patterns, often flaunting an assortment of colors and patterns that are seemingly impossible. These wolves are known for their high aggression and their unusually large packs. A pack of Legion Warriors can be in the hundreds, and their territories can stretch out into sizes that can compete with a small country. Legion Warriors are incredibly loyal, and very intelligent. They've taken the typical pack rankings and organized them into a system, even learning the wield as assortment of weapons. A few even know magic. A pack is usually controlled by a single Alpha, possibly with his or her mate. A Legion Warrior's diet is primarily carnivorous, and they tend to live in colder climates. They do not mate for life, and usually produce one or two offspring per breeding.
